Government rakes in over $415M from Big Three carriers in residual spectrum auction

The federal government announced the provisional results of its latest auction of residual spectrum licences on Friday, with Canada’s major telecommunications carriers committing hundreds of millions of dollars to expand their wireless coverage across the country.
